Exedy is the clutch I put in mine 2004 and was the same as the one that was in there. I changed it because the throw out bearing was starting to whine. I really didn't have to change the clutch. They tell you since you got the transmission out do it. No problems with the Exedy. I did the clutch in two days. A impact makes the job so much easier.
